GamingTurtle's Badges » Hard » Most AwardedAll Badges
Sort:
Badge earned
Never Gonna Let You Down Badge
(completed)
GamingTurtle earned this badge in Music Catch 2 on Jan. 28, 2010.
Badge earned
99 Dead Balloons Badge
(completed)
GamingTurtle earned this badge in Bloons Tower Defense 3 on Jan. 28, 2010.
Badge earned
Champion Robotics Engineer Badge
(completed)
GamingTurtle earned this badge in Bot Arena 3 on Mar. 03, 2010.
|